Introduction:
From the source in the early nineteenth century to its quickly developing kind in the twenty-first century, poker features undeniably become an internationally sensation. Using the introduction of technology, the standard card online game has actually transitioned to the digital realm, fascinating millions of players through online poker systems. This report explores the interesting realm of internet poker, its advantages, drawbacks, and the reasons behind its growing popularity.

Among the major known reasons for the widespread selling point of internet poker is its accessibility. In comparison to brick-and-mortar casinos, on-line poker platforms offer players the freedom to play whenever, anywhere. With a reliable web connection, poker enthusiasts will enjoy their favorite game from the absolute comfort of their particular domiciles, getting rid of the necessity for travel. Furthermore, on-line poker websites provide many choices, including various variants of poker, tournaments, as well as other risk amounts, providing to players of all skill amounts.

2. Worldwide Player Base:
Online poker transcends geographical boundaries, allowing players from all corners regarding the world to compete keenly against each other.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and challenging environment, enabling players to check their abilities against opponents with differing methods and playing types. Furthermore, online poker platforms often function radiant communities in which players can discuss methods, share experiences, and take part in friendly competitors.

3. Lower Prices and Smaller Stakes:
Compared to standard casinos, playing poker on the web can notably reduce costs. On line systems have reduced overhead expenses, allowing them to provide lower stakes and reduced entry costs for tournaments. This will make on-line poker accessible to a wider audience, including newbies and everyday people, who may find the large stakes of real time casinos daunting. The ability to fool around with smaller stakes in addition provides a sense of financial safety, permitting people to manage their bankroll better.

4. Enhanced Game Access and Range:
Internet poker platforms provide a massive variety of online game options and variations. Whether it is texas hold em,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, players will find their particular preferred game effortlessly and immediately. Furthermore, on the web platforms usually introduce brand new poker variations, spicing up just click the following website game play and keeping the experience fresh for people. The availability of a variety of tables and tournaments ensures that players constantly discover suitable choices and never having to watch for a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While internet poker brings many benefits, it isn't without its difficulties. The major disadvantages may be the prospect of fraudulent t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, in which people cheat to get an unfair advantage. However, reputable on-line poker systems employ sturdy safety measures and random number generators to thwart these types of behavior. In addition, some players could find the absence of physical cues and communications that are element of real time po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to see opponents and use psychological techniques online.
